Series background & context
The Matchmaker of Edinburgh books are set in a richly drawn nineteenth century Scotland where a single woman quietly shapes society from the shadows. Moira Sullivan is the matchmaker of the title, a sharp minded widow who runs salons, trades in secrets, and uses her connections to steer people toward the partners they truly need.
Each novel follows a different couple whose lives brush up against Moira's world. In The Look of Love, accomplished sculptor Ina Duncan has spent years avoiding marriage so she can keep working. One near scandalous encounter leaves her reputation in jeopardy and sends her straight into a marriage of convenience with her best friend, Gavin Barrett, a baronet's second son who has been in love with her for years.
The Taste of Temptation introduces Caroline Burkett, an Englishwoman who sues her former fiancé and becomes a scandal in the London papers. Hoping to start over in Edinburgh, she seeks Moira's help, only to catch the attention of Jonathan Moray, a self made newspaper owner hunting for big stories. Their romance plays out against a backdrop of gossip columns, political ambitions, and the power the press holds over a woman's name.
In The Allure of Attraction, widowed dressmaker Lavinia Parkem is reunited with Andrew Colter, the sea captain she once expected to marry before news of his shipwreck forced her into another match. Years later, Andrew has become a naval officer and occasional spy. When he is tasked with infiltrating the household of a banker suspected of plotting against the Prince of Wales, he needs Lavinia's access to that world and Moira's help in convincing her.
Across the series, Kelly lingers on the details of Edinburgh life, from newspaper offices and artist studios to ballrooms and quiet back streets. The tone balances warmth with stakes, showing how much these women stand to lose if they choose wrong while still delivering emotionally satisfying, romantic endings.
Although each book stands on its own, reading them in order lets you watch Moira move pieces around the board and see secondary characters step into the spotlight. It is a compact, character driven series that will appeal to readers who like their historical romance threaded through with ambition, friendship, and a city that feels alive on the page.
